In recent years, the gaming industry has witnessed unprecedented growth, becoming a cornerstone of digital entertainment. As we progress into the mid-2020s, developments in technology have propelled gaming into a new era, blending immersive experiences with cutting-edge innovation.

One of the most noticeable trends is the shift towards cloud gaming. Services like GeForce Now and Xbox Cloud Gaming have capitalized on the growing availability of high-speed internet, allowing players to stream games without the need for expensive hardware. This evolution not only democratizes gaming access but also pushes the boundaries of what's possible in gameplay and graphics.

Another significant development is the rise of virtual reality (VR) gaming. With strides in VR technology, players are now able to engage with digital environments in an unprecedented manner. Companies like Oculus and Sony are spearheading this movement, delivering headsets that transport users into alternate realities, making gaming more interactive than ever before.

Esports, too, has continued its meteoric rise, cementing itself as a major facet of modern sports culture. Tournaments drawing millions in prize money attract audiences akin to traditional sporting events, with platforms such as Twitch enabling fans to follow their favorite teams and players in real-time.

The convergence of social media and gaming has also reshaped the industry's landscape. Platforms that integrate video sharing, live streaming, and community interaction have cultivated a new generation of influencers and content creators, blurring the lines between player and celebrity.
